It's sooooo easy Kimbers. This is what happened when I used it at T2 in May. Follow the Meet and Greet signs from the roundabout at the bottom of the hill when you enter the airport and drive up to their arrival point, Make sure you stop under the canopy (well there's a barrier there anyway!) so that their cameras can record the condition of your car. Then, when the barrier allows, follow the signs until you can turn right into the M&G lanes. Someone will be there to direct you.

I'll disagree and say it isn't obvious, or at least wasn't obvious from the info that Holiday Extras gave us! We went were it said but the barrier wouldn't open but luckily someone who was just arriving at work told us where we actually needed to be which is just off the roundabout where the Radisson is. Even then though, off that roundabout it's sort of behind it from the direction you're coming from so wasn't immediately obvious with all the boarding up everywhere and big trees on the roundabout. If you look on Google Maps it's on Atlanta Avenue.
